117.info
人生若只如初见

如何在Linux Informix中进行数据迁移

在Linux Informix中进行数据迁移可以按照以下步骤进行:

  1. 环境准备

    • 确保源数据库和目标数据库的操作系统和硬件要求一致。
    • 了解源数据库的版本和配置。
  2. 数据迁移计划

    • 根据业务需求和数据量大小,选择合适的迁移方法,如物理备份和还原、逻辑导出和导入、ETL工具等。
  3. 数据库结构迁移

    • 在目标数据库中创建相应的表、索引、触发器等对象,根据需要调整数据类型、长度、约束等定义。
  4. 数据迁移

    • 使用二进制迁移工具(如ontapeon-baronunload)或文本迁移工具(如dbexportdbimportunloadloaddbloadexternal tablehigh performance loader)执行实际的数据迁移操作。
  5. 应用程序迁移

    • 修改应用程序的连接字符串、SQL语句等,以适应目标数据库的语法和特性。
  6. 测试和验证

    • 对迁移后的数据库和应用程序进行充分的测试和验证,确保数据的准确性、性能的稳定性、功能的一致性。
  7. 迁移后的运维

    • 确保数据库和应用程序的正常运行,监控和优化性能,及时处理问题和异常。

一些具体的命令示例:

  • 导出数据库

    dbexport -o /informix/db_export stores7
    
  • 导入数据库

    dbimport -i /home/informix/db_export dbname -c -l buffered update statistics
    
  • 创建表空间

    onspaces -c -d new_table_space -p /path/to/datafile -o offset -s tablespace_size
    

通过以上步骤和命令,您可以顺利完成Linux Informix数据库的迁移工作。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fefe1AzsKCARRB10.html

推荐文章

  • 怎样用FetchLinux管理Linux服务器

    FetchLinux是一个用于构建和部署Linux发行版的自动化工具,它可以帮助系统管理员自动化许多管理任务,提高工作效率。以下是使用FetchLinux管理Linux服务器的基本...

  • 如何用yum搜索Linux软件资源

    使用yum搜索Linux软件资源的步骤如下:
    在CentOS/RHEL 7及以下版本中 打开终端: 使用快捷键 Ctrl + Alt + T 或者通过开始菜单找到并打开终端。 更新yum缓存...

  • 如何用GIMP进行图像编辑

    GIMP是一款功能强大的开源图像编辑软件,适用于Windows、Mac OS和Linux平台。以下是一些基本的使用步骤和功能介绍:
    安装GIMP 访问GIMP官网:https://www.g...

  • Linux syslog如何提高系统安全性

    Linux syslog是一个用于记录系统日志的守护进程,它可以帮助我们监控和诊断系统问题。通过合理配置和使用syslog,可以提高系统安全性。以下是一些建议: 配置sys...

  • 怎样让CentOS支持Golang多版本

    在CentOS上支持Golang多版本,可以通过以下步骤实现: 安装多个版本的Golang 首先,你需要安装你需要的Golang版本。你可以从官方网站下载所需版本的Golang二进制...

  • 如何通过Linux Swagger进行API监控

    在Linux环境下,Swagger(现更名为OpenAPI Specification)主要用于提供RESTful API的文档化、可视化、测试和代码生成等功能,从而简化API的开发、测试和维护过程...

  • Debian Apache如何实现反向代理

    在Debian系统上使用Apache实现反向代理,通常会借助mod_proxy和相关的模块。以下是详细的步骤指南:
    1. 安装Apache
    首先,确保你已经安装了Apache服务...

  • 如何设置Ubuntu Node.js日志保留期限

    在Ubuntu系统中,设置Node.js应用程序的日志保留期限可以通过多种方式实现,具体取决于你使用的日志管理工具。以下是几种常见的方法:
    方法一:使用logrota...